SAN DIEGO — A 2022 decision from California Governor Gavin Newsom to reverse parole for former skateboarding icon, Mark ‘Gator’ Rogowski, for the brutal 1991 rape and murder of Jessica Bergsten in Carlsbad will stand, ruled a California Appellate Court last week.
In a May 22 ruling, an appellate panel refused to overturn Governor Newsom’s parole reversal, meaning the 1980s skateboard star will not be released from prison without a new parole hearing.
Since 2019, the board granted parole two consecutive times parole commissioners granted him parole for the vicious rape and murder of 22-year-old Jessica Bergsten on May 21, 1991. Each of those times, Governor Gavin Newsom reversed the board’s decision…
